Reduce Unused CSS to technika optymalizacji stron internetowych, która polega na usuwaniu zbędnych lub nieużywanych reguł CSS, czyli kaskadowych arkuszy stylów, z kodu strony. Dzięki tej metodzie strona może działać szybciej, ponieważ zmniejsza się rozmiar plików CSS, a tym samym czas ładowania witryny. Zbyt duża ilość nieużywanego kodu w arkuszach stylów może prowadzić do spowolnienia działania strony, szczególnie jeśli chodzi o urządzenia mobilne, gdzie użytkownicy oczekują szybkości i płynności w działaniu witryny. Zredukowanie niepotrzebnego kodu CSS pozwala na zoptymalizowanie wydajności strony, co wpływa na lepsze doświadczenie użytkowników, którzy korzystają z niej na różnych urządzeniach.
Kiedy mówimy o redukcji nieużywanego CSS, warto zacząć od analizy całego arkusza stylów i sprawdzenia, które jego elementy są rzeczywiście wykorzystywane na stronie, a które nie mają wpływu na jej wygląd. Często zdarza się, że w kodzie znajdują się reguły, które były potrzebne w przeszłości, ale zostały zapomniane lub zastąpione innymi rozwiązaniami. Te elementy mogą pozostać w plikach CSS, mimo że nie są już wykorzystywane. Usunięcie takich niepotrzebnych fragmentów kodu przyczynia się do zwiększenia szybkości ładowania strony oraz zmniejszenia jej rozmiaru. Mniejsze pliki CSS to także mniejsze obciążenie serwera oraz mniejsza ilość danych do przesłania, co ma szczególne znaczenie w przypadku użytkowników z wolniejszym połączeniem internetowym.
W procesie redukcji nieużywanego CSS warto skupić się na dwóch głównych obszarach: usuwaniu stylów, które nie są stosowane w żadnym z elementów strony, oraz na minimalizacji reguł, które są nadmiarowe lub można je zastąpić bardziej efektywnymi rozwiązaniami. W wielu przypadkach można użyć narzędzi, które automatycznie analizują kod i wskazują, które fragmenty są nieużywane. Warto jednak pamiętać, że manualne sprawdzenie kodu i jego optymalizacja przez programistów jest również ważnym krokiem, aby upewnić się, że nie zostaną usunięte reguły, które wciąż mogą mieć zastosowanie. W końcu chodzi o to, by nie tylko poprawić wydajność strony, ale także zachować jej funkcjonalność i wygląd.
Usuwanie nieużywanego CSS ma również wpływ na SEO, ponieważ szybkość ładowania strony jest jednym z czynników, które Google bierze pod uwagę przy ustalaniu pozycji w wynikach wyszukiwania. Strony, które ładują się szybciej, mają większe szanse na lepsze rankingi w wyszukiwarkach. Dodatkowo, użytkownicy, którzy odwiedzają strony szybko ładujące się, mają mniejsze skłonności do rezygnacji z ich przeglądania, co przekłada się na mniejszy współczynnik odrzuceń (bounce rate) i większe zaangażowanie. Dzięki redukcji nieużywanego CSS, strona staje się bardziej efektywna, a jej czas ładowania jest krótszy, co ma istotne znaczenie z punktu widzenia SEO.
Warto zauważyć, że redukcja nieużywanego CSS jest tylko jednym z elementów optymalizacji strony internetowej. W połączeniu z innymi technikami, takimi jak kompresja obrazów, minimalizacja skryptów JavaScript czy optymalizacja wydajności serwera, może znacząco wpłynąć na poprawę jakości strony. Regularne przeglądanie i optymalizacja kodu CSS jest istotnym krokiem w dążeniu do stworzenia strony, która działa szybko i sprawnie, a także dostarcza użytkownikom pozytywnych wrażeń podczas jej przeglądania. Dzięki tym działaniom strona może zyskać na wydajności, a także na zadowoleniu użytkowników, którzy będą chętniej korzystać z witryny.